Output 8627a67f397fcd2ecf62b9d7d126571f033394b586a40622684e6cbd111717d2:1

value
20315346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ea2c4da3d0510ae0181f31e84166668c90ccfbfa OP_EQUAL
address
3P3D7gH1mywVU8pnfD9yL6ysnJe5q5YssJ
transaction
8627a67f397fcd2ecf62b9d7d126571f033394b586a40622684e6cbd111717d2
spent
true